What is Chiropractic Care for Horses?

Chiropractic care for horses involves manual therapies that aim to restore normal joint function and improve the nervous system’s performance. Practitioners use their hands to apply controlled force to joints that have become restricted in movement. This therapy is particularly beneficial for equine athletes, as it can enhance their performance and prevent injuries.

How to Identify If Your Horse Needs Chiropractic Care

Signs Your Horse Might Benefit from Chiropractic Care

  • Stiffness or Uneven Gait: If your horse shows signs of stiffness or an uneven gait, it may benefit from chiropractic adjustments.
  • Behavioral Changes: Sudden changes in behavior, such as reluctance to work, could indicate discomfort that chiropractic care can address.
  • Performance Issues: A decline in performance can be a sign of underlying musculoskeletal issues that chiropractic care can help resolve.

When to Consult a Chiropractor

If you notice any of the above signs, it may be time to consult a licensed equine chiropractor. They can assess your horse’s condition and recommend a treatment plan tailored to their needs.

What Should I Expect During a Chiropractic Session for My Horse?

During a chiropractic session, the practitioner will assess your horse’s posture, movement, and spinal alignment. They will then perform adjustments using their hands to apply precise force to specific joints. Sessions typically last between 30 to 60 minutes.

How Often Should My Horse Receive Chiropractic Care?

The frequency of chiropractic care depends on the horse’s condition and workload. For performance horses, bi-weekly or monthly sessions may be beneficial, while leisure horses might only need adjustments a few times a year.
